Which Type of Boat is Best for You? Top 10 Choices for Boaters - myboat014 boatplans Feb 15, �� Jon boats are extremely popular, not only across North America, but in many parts of the world. They are used for inland-water transportation, water-based utility work, fresh water fishing and duck hunting. Their flat bottom design makes them excellent for traversing shallow waterways but this design does create some usage restrictions. Keeping in mind that the environment plays a major role in the choice of Jon boat size here we will delve into the best sizes for the most common activities associated with Jon boats.

For example, a large 20 foot Jon boat will allow you to store a lot more equipment but a smaller 10 foot boat is easier to hide when hunting. A smaller boat is also a lot easier to push off sandbars than a larger one as well. If you plan to hunt in packs then a smaller Jon boat would be impractical. Even 1 person on a 10 foot Jon boat with full duck hunting gear can make the boat feel rather cramped. While a 17 foot Jon boat should be able to accommodate 3 experienced men with gear, in optimal weather conditions, if the weather turns bad or you have inexperienced passengers onboard you could run into trouble on the stability front.

It will probably also feel a bit crowded. A 18 foot Are Jon Boats Good For Saltwater Lyrics Jon boat should be big enough to haul dogs and decoys in large lakes. It should also be stable enough to handle fairly rough waters within reason. If you hunt in small lakes and ponds then a small Jon boat, 10 foot or 12 foot, will be more than enough for the job. Many hunters argue that a semi-v hull is better than a flat bottom but bear in mind that this will cause problems should you need to access very shallow areas such as banks.

We recommend sticking to a boat with a flat bottomed hull as it has a very shallow draft that will allow you access to many more hunting areas. Although most bass fishermen prefer to use a Bass boat , Jon boats are still very popular because they can be used for other activities as well.

Flat bottom boats are perfect for bowfishing as the shallow draft of the boat lets it access areas that deeper draft boats could not enter read more about shallow draft vs deep draft here. They are also exceptionally stable in calm water. The flat bottom design also makes it easier to add a shooting platform on the deck as shown in the image below. As with bass fishing and duck hunting you need to consider the size of the bodies of water that you intend to fish in as this will determine the best size of Jon boat.

Aluminum Jon boats are a very popular choice for bowfishing. Although aluminum is exceptionally long lasting in freshwater it corrodes easily in saltwater. So, if you intend to also use your boat in saltwater you may be better with a fiberglass boat or you can build your own wooden boat as we demonstrated here. Be aware that a Jon boat is not the only choice for this type of activity though they are by far the most popular. For example, a fiberglass flat-bottomed skiff is also very popular among anglers for bowfishing.

As most of skiffs will be powered by a trolling motor you need to take that into account as the boat will have a deeper draft due to the propeller whereas a Jon boat can have its engine disengaged and be moved via manual propulsion in very shallow areas. Pontoon boats also serve really well as bowfishing vessels as they are both very stable in calm waters and offer a very wide platform to shoot from.

A pontoon boat gives you the added advantage of installing more lights should you wish to bowfish in failing light or at night. Although the same basic rules apply to buying a bowfishing Jon boat as apply when wanting a boat for bass fishing or hunting, when it comes to bowfishing you should really go for the biggest boat you can afford. A larger boat offers more stability and will give you much more room and space to move thus helping to improve your shot accuracy.

It is unlikely you will buy a Jon boat, new or used, that has already been setup for Are Jon Boats Good For Rivers University bowfishing. So before you choose one make sure it can accommodate all your equipment, if using lights for instance, and that it offers enough stability and room for accurate shooting.

Although it is not a major requirement for a bowfishing boat it is advantageous to have a deck or a platform on the boat with enough space for you to aim and shoot. On a Jon boat without a modified shooting deck you can still stand on the deck or the seats to aim your shots and the boat should remain very stable while in calm water. It is true that many Jon boat buyers will settle for a smaller motor when the boat they are buying is capable of accommodating a bigger one.

Although this may be true if the Jon boat is being used as a utility boat or for transportation, or even if there are large areas between hunting or fishing grounds, it is not always a good idea to get a bigger motor.

Most hunters and anglers will prefer a reliable, quieter engine over a more powerful counterpart for obvious reasons. A noisy engine will scare away fish and airborne prey alike and big engines can be heard from a fairly long distance away.

So the rule-of-thumb is to get as big an outboard motor as your Jon boat can handle, especially if you need speed or you travel long distances in your boat, but if you hunt or fish in relatively small waters a smaller quieter Are Jon Boats Good For Rivers Underwear motor is a better choice. For this reason when it comes to bass fishing and bowfishing many Jon boat owners prefer quiet engines and they will also ensure their boat has additional manual means of propulsion such as oars or a paddle so they can navigate hunting areas quietly.

On that note, regardless of what size of motor you use, you should always have some form manual propulsion in your boat for safety reasons anyway as we outlined in the article how to drive a flat bottom boat. Modified V-hull jon boats work on choppier waters. If you want to use your jon boat on rivers or lakes where there may be more chop to deal with, then a modified V-hull may be your best bet. This design includes a V area in the front of the hull, rather than the traditional flat bottom traditional jon boat design.

Realistically, if you are planning on boating on waters that do have a fair amount of wave action, then a jon boat may not be the best option. You may want to look at a boat that has a V-hull, which provides more cutting action through heavier waters. These boats can be found in a range of prices.

Get Licensed. Back Close. Is a 14 ft ok, or does it need to be like 16 ft or larger? That would all depend on how big the lake is, how active is the boat traffic, and in what part of the lake you're in.

I've taken my 12' on some fairly large lakes, but those don't see very much boat activity. I sure wouldn't want to take it out and run around the middle of Okeechobee with it. If I'm not mistaken, width is more important than length in a jon boat.

I've heard the " ones are really quite stable. I agree. Try to find one with a floor width of 48" wide. If you can't, a 42" wide floor would probably be OK. We have a Yeah you'll rock but it suits me and one other just fine. We love it. You'll want the biggest possible if you're going to be out in open water on windy days with lots of boat traffic. The smallest boat will do fine if you're in a protected area, regardless of lake size.

I do all of my fishing out of a 12' deep v, as long as you know your equipment, and yourself, the sky is the limit. I've fished Presqile in my rig, but I'm usually within pitchin' distance from shore.

I've fished a few large lakes in my 14' X 36" jon boat but I was very selective about when I did so.
